原创 多個虛擬機網絡互通

虛擬機網絡設置雙網卡: 1、NAT 2、HOSTONLY

原创 SSH登陸遠程主機後進入指定目錄或執行命令

ssh user@hostname -t 'cd /apps/app1/logs; bash --login' ssh user@hostname -t 'ls -l; bash --login'

原创 Java系統多個JSSE認證

問題描述: 由於項目需要,系統需要多個JSSE認證(登錄使用SSL、郵件收取) 解決辦法: 一、對於需要一次JSSE認證來說,可以通過 1、InstallCert工具來安裝證書 /* * Copyright 2006 Sun M

原创 UnderScore.js統計字符出現頻率

//方法一 var words = 'Also known as inject and foldl reduce boils down a list of values into a single value.' + ' Memo is

原创 Gson在不知道對象結構的情況下遍歷各個字段

public static void main(String[] args) { Person p1 = new Person("zhang",20); Person p2 = new Person

原创 joda-time實現Timehelper

import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date;

原创 Gson自定義轉換器轉換成不同的子類

public static void main(String[] args) { String personStr1 = "{\"id\":\"123456\",\"product_category\":\"101\",\

原创 Gson轉換同父類不同子類列表

import com.google.gson.*; import com.google.gson.reflect.TypeToken; import java.lang.reflect.Type; import java.util.Arr

原创 分佈式協調服務ZooKeeper

概念 ZooKeeper是一個分佈式的,開放源碼的分佈式應用程序協調服務,是Google的Chubby一個開源的實現。 ZooKeeper中的角色主要有以下三類,如下表所示:     系統模型                 

原创 Git別名調用自定義操作

1、cat ~/.gitconfig [alias]     st = status     ci = commit     df = diff     co = checkout     br = branch     diffall

原创 Telnet命令訪問Redis緩存

1、telnet 192.168.0.1 6601 2、info       --master4:name=my-cache,status=ok,address=192.168.0.1:3313,slaves=2,sentinels=3

原创 Java實現截圖並保存到本地

?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23

原创 【泛型】Gson的序列化和反序列化

數據結構 public class Pagination<T> { private T data; }class Person{ private String name; private int age;

原创 Gradle入門

隨着Android Studio越來越完善,更多的開發者捨棄掉Eclipse。但是新的IDE與以往的Eclipse有很大區別,這導致部分開發者望而卻步,其中一個大家覺得比較麻煩的是Android Studio採用的新的構建系統,gr

原创 大數據串講-從日誌文件分析訪問量最高的10個接口及響應訪問量

安裝軟件 Hadoop 安裝Hadoop 2.6.1 參考:http://www.powerxing.com/install-hadoop/ Hive 安裝Hive 2.1.1 參考 :https://my.oschina.net/ja